Question : Which among the following socio-religious communities was founded by Raja Ram Mohan Roy?
Option 1: Prarthana Samaj
Option 2: Arya Samaj
Option 3: Akali Dal
Option 4: Brahmo Samaj
Correct Answer: Brahmo Samaj
Solution : The correct answer is Brahmo Samaj.
The Brahmo Sabha, subsequently known as the Brahmo Samaj, was established by Raja Ram Mohan Roy.

Question : A. R. Rahman won the Grammy Awards for which movie?
Option 1: Slumdog Millionaire
Option 2: Roja
Option 3: Lagaan
Option 4: Dil Se
Correct Answer: Slumdog Millionaire
Solution : The correct option is Slumdog Millionaire.
A. R. Rahman won the Grammy Awards for his work on the soundtrack of the movie "Slumdog Millionaire". The film was directed by Danny Boyle. Rahman won this award specifically for the song Jai Ho.
